About the role

As the Facilities Operations Supervisor at xAI Memphis, you will oversee the maintenance and performance of critical data center infrastructure, including power, cooling, and environmental systems. You will lead a team of Facilities Operations Technicians, driving hands-on technical operations, team leadership, process optimization, and cross-functional collaboration to ensure the reliability and efficiency of our data center. This role emphasizes fostering a team-first culture, prioritizing team focus, and promoting a collaborative work environment.

Responsibilities

  • Lead and mentor a team of Facilities Operations Technicians, fostering a culture of excellence, collaboration, and continuous improvement.
  • Oversee maintenance, monitoring, and troubleshooting of data center infrastructure, including HVAC, power distribution, and backup systems.
  • Create and enforce standard operating procedures (SOPs) to ensure operational consistency and efficiency.
  • Ensure compliance with safety regulations and industry standards.
  • Collaborate with engineering and procurement teams to streamline equipment intake, installation, and maintenance processes.
  • Utilize internal applications for inventory and asset management, ensuring accurate tracking and reporting.
  • Manage critical equipment maintenance and repairs, ensuring timely resolution and detailed documentation.
  • Partner with cross-functional teams to support seamless data center operations.
  • Lead initiatives to enhance operational efficiency and minimize downtime.
  • Provide on-call support and respond promptly to critical facilities incidents.

Basic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ical, Electrical, or a related engineering field (relevant experience may substitute for degree).
  • 4+ years of experience managing critical facilities systems, including power, cooling, and environmental controls.
  • In-depth knowledge of electrical, mechanical, and HVAC systems in data centers.
  • 4+ years of experience troubleshooting and maintaining critical facilities infrastructure.
  • Proficiency with building management systems (BMS) and environmental monitoring tools.
  • Proven leadership experience in critical facilities or technical operations environments.
  • Demonstrated ability to lead facilities infrastructure projects.
  • Proficiency with hand tools and power tools.
  • Strong prioritization and time management skills.
  • Able to thrive in a fast-paced environment while maintaining attention to detail.
  • Must pass pre-employment and annual post-employment background checks.
  • Physical Requirements:
    • Ability to lift up to 35 lbs. unassisted.
    • Comfortable working at heights up to 50 feet with appropriate safety gear.
    • Ability to work in environments with exposure to noise.
    • Physical dexterity to perform job functions in confined spaces.

Availability

  • Available to work evenings and weekends based on site operational needs; flexibility is required.
  • Valid driver’s license.

PREFERRED S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E

  • Experience programming PLC-based control systems or working with Building Management Systems.
  • Project Management Professional (PMP) certification or equivalent.
  • EPA Universal Refrigerant Certification (EPA 608 Technician).
